While Shimano Ultegra stands as an excellent choice, several other premium groupsets deserve consideration for your road bike upgrade. SRAM Force AXS brings wireless shifting technology to the mid-high tier market, offering crisp electronic shifts without cables. Campagnolo Chorus provides Italian craftsmanship with distinctive ergonomics and smooth mechanical operation. For electronic enthusiasts, Shimano's own 105 Di2 offers similar wireless convenience at a lower price point, while SRAM Rival AXS delivers wireless performance at an even more accessible level. Campagnolo Super Record and SRAM Red AXS represent the absolute pinnacle of their respective brands, though at premium pricing that rivals Dura-Ace.
Shimano Ultegra occupies the second tier in Shimano's road groupset lineup, positioned strategically between the professional-grade Dura-Ace and the enthusiast-focused 105 series. This positioning allows Ultegra to incorporate many of Dura-Ace's advanced technologies while maintaining a more reasonable price structure. The weight difference between Ultegra and Dura-Ace is minimal, typically less than 100 grams for a complete groupset, making Ultegra an intelligent choice for performance-oriented riders. Recent generations have introduced features like semi-wireless shifting in Ultegra Di2 and improved hydraulic brake feel, bringing professional-level performance to serious recreational and competitive cyclists who want the best bang for their buck.
